Step-by-Step Guide to Deleting Friends on Snapchat
Deleting friends on Snapchat is a fairly straightforward process.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you safely and effectively remove unwanted friends:
-
Open Snapchat and navigate to the “Chats” section. Here, you’ll find a list of all your friends and conversations.
-
Tap on the friend you wish to delete, then select their name from the top-right corner of the screen.
-
scroll down to the bottom of the profile screen, and you’ll find a “Remove Friend” option. Tap on this.
-
Confirm that you want to remove the friend by tapping “Remove” in the popup window.

Q: Can I delete friends on Snapchat on my phone’s web browser?
A: Unfortunately, no. You can only delete friends on Snapchat through the mobile app.
Q: Will deleting a friend on Snapchat block them from seeing my content?
A: Not necessarily. Deleting a friend on Snapchat won’t block them from seeing your public content, but it will limit their ability to see your stories and chats.

Q: Will deleting a friend on Snapchat affect their account?
A: No, deleting a friend on Snapchat won’t affect their account in any way. It’s purely a unilateral decision that only affects your friend list.
